In its fourth weekend in a row, The First Slam Dunk has continued its stay at number one at the Japanese Box Office, passing 5 Billion Yen this weekend on 2.81 million admissions according to the latest box office numbers.

Meanwhile, James Cameron’s latest Avatar sequel, Avatar: The Way of Water, had another successful weekend in North America despite the winter weather. In Japan, however, it was a different story. The Way of Water stuck to Number Three with 1.44 Billion Yen. Toei Animation continues its impressive Box Office Streak for 2022, making The First Slam Dunk the first big blockbuster of the new Japanese box office year, which runs from December 2022 to November 2023.
Toei Animation and DandeLion Animation Studio are animating the movie. Original mangaka Takehiko Inoue is directing the movie and writing the screenplay. Yasuyuki Ebara is doing character designs and also serving as chief animation director. The series is currently streaming on Crunchyroll.

The First Slam Dunk is now playing in theaters and IMAX in Japan. This iconic Sports Manga ran in Shueisha’s Weekly Shonen Jump magazine from 1990 to 1996 for a total of 31 volumes. The manga inspired a television anime in 1993 and had four anime film sequels. Viz Media released all 31 volumes of the manga in English.
